One egg a day can help you lose weight: Study

News posted by www.newsinfoline.com

We all know that egg is one of the most nutrient-dense foods, but now a new study claims eating one egg daily can help fight obesity.The British study, which analysed 71 research papers on the nutritional composition of eggs and their role in diet, found that eggs are packed with vitamin D, vitamin B12, selenium and choline that could also play a significant role in dieting and weight loss.According to the researchers, a medium-sized egg has fewer than 80 calories and provides more than 20 per cent of the recommended daily allowance.Dr Carrie Ruxton, an independent dietitian and lead author of the report, said: "There are clear nutritional benefits to eating eggs on a regular basis. Emerging evidence suggests that eggs may be beneficial for satiety, weight control and eye health."With previous limits on egg consumption lifted, most people would benefit from a return to the days of going to work on an egg."
